Key Responsibilities
Conduct Functional Behavior Assessments (FBAs) and develop individualized treatment plans.
Implement and oversee ABA treatment plans for clients in clinic and in home, as required by the treatment plan.
Lead, supervise, and mentor a team of RBTs/BTs in the delivery of 1:1 ABA therapy. Assist in deepening their knowledge and skill base, overcoming challenges and improving their client interactions.
Analyze data to monitor client outcomes and update treatment plans to achieve consistent progress. Prepare regular progress reports.
Provide training to family members and other client stakeholders in accordance with treatment plans and BACB standards of care.
Coordinate with clinic’s speech-language pathologists and occupational therapists ot enhance outcomes across specialties.
Communicate clearly and consistently with families and caregivers.
Ensure compliance with BACB ethical guidelines.
Ensure documentation meets ethical, payor, and regulatory requirements.
Qualifications
Master’s degree in ABA, psychology, education, or related field
Must be Board Certified by BACB and in good standing with a clean background check
Minimum 1 years’ experience as a BCBA preferred
Background in early intervention and autism strongly preferred
Solid communication skills, organizational skills, and openness to feedback
Passion for mentoring others and building strong systems of care
Valid Driver’s License
Physical requirements: bend, kneel, sit on floor, go from sitting to standing unassisted, lift up to 50 lbs.
